Persistent Cough as a Primary Indicator A cough that lingers for three weeks or longer is one of the most common and telling signs of tuberculosis. If you or someone you know experiences a persistent cough alongside systemic symptoms like fever or night sweats, consulting a healthcare professional is the most responsible course of action.

Unexplained Weight Loss and Fatigue Significant weight loss without trying and a persistent feeling of exhaustion are classic signs of tuberculosis. This fatigue is not just tiredness after a long day; it is a profound lack of energy that rest does not easily alleviate.
